ELSKA is music-driven preschool series set on the edge of the Arctic Circle, where a cast of characters celebrate free-play, imagination, and wonder. After an oil spill upends her fishing village, Elska leaves home and discovers a small Arctic island teeming with quirky creatures and a colony of lost socks who embrace her as family. Each episode is a music-filled journey filled with discovery, resilience, and friendship, inviting young viewers to explore everything from geothermal activity to painting to friendship, bravery and always the breathtaking wonder of the Arctic. Each adventure is scored with Elska’s award-winning, critically acclaimed, pop-electronic music.

Imagined as a combination of live action and animation, the first season of 26 x 11’ episodes follows Elska’s first year on the island as she experiences the wonder and challenges of the four Arctic seasons. As she explores, Elska builds a home, forms unexpected friendships, and maps the island’s breathtaking fjords and geothermal wonders to its mossy fields of lava rocks. Through her adventures and with the support from her friends, Elska confronts her fears to become a brave Arctic pioneer.

MUSIC & DANCE

In ELSKA, music and dance are integral to the storytelling, enriching each episode with playful energy and engagement. The series features original pop-electronic compositions, including both instrumental and lyrical songs, designed to encourage children to sing and dance along with the characters. Elska’s music has been recognized with prestigious awards, including the Parents’ Choice Silver Award and the NAPPA Award. The music has also achieved significant commercial success, with multiple tracks reaching #1 on SiriusXM’s leading children’s music channel. All music is written and produced by Shelley Wollert, who brings an award-winning album to the project, along with 60 additional unreleased tracks.

Elska’s choreography incorporates modern dance styles reminiscent of David Byrne’s bold gestures from Stop Making Sense, alongside elements of hip-hop dance. Children are encouraged to dance along with the music and/or mirroring Elska through choreoghaphed hand gestures that follow the lyrics of songs.

GUIDING PRINCIPLE: PLAYFUL MINIMALISM

While creating ELSKA, the team continually asked two simple questions: “Is it playful?” and “Is it minimalist?”

Inspired by collaborations with educators from Iceland and the UK, we embraced the concept of “free play”—giving children just enough elements to spark their imaginations. This approach celebrates minimalism as a means to fostering open-ended experiences that encourage creativity and self-expression.

Elska invites children to explore, interpret, and contribute their own ideas to the series. We play with colors, shapes, and sounds as if they were simple building blocks, so that curiosity thrives and imagination leads the way.

Educational & Emotional Themes

ELSKA is a preschool series that offers rich educational opportunities through engaging storytelling, music, and imaginative play. Set against the vibrant backdrop of a whimsical Arctic island, the series introduces young viewers to a variety of educational themes, including geothermal activity, geology, weather, the aurora borealis, Arctic animals and flora, navigation, and even gardening. Through creative exploration of the arts—singing, dancing, writing, and painting—children are encouraged to express themselves while learning about the world around them.

Alongside these educational opportunities, ELSKA fosters emotional growth by addressing important themes such as friendship, teamwork, courage, self-confidence, and belonging. The series gently navigates complex feelings like loss, loneliness, fear, and the challenges of saying goodbye, while celebrating the power of free play, imagination, and the bravery it takes to face new experiences.

Elska’s Map of the Island

The Island of Elska is divided into four distinct quadrants—North, East, South, and West—each with unique topography. Elska lives in the West, surrounded by tiny pine forests and views of the Whale Trail, where whales migrate. The North features Puffin Cove, the Tumbled Mountains, and Fox's Fjordland, while the East boasts geothermal activity due to Mount Glimpi, the island’s active volcano. In the South, black sand beaches and moss-covered lava fields create a striking, rugged landscape.
